The Benefits of High-Quality Slow-Release Organic Fertilizers


In recent years, the demand for sustainable agricultural practices has surged, as more growers seek to balance productivity with environmental health. One approach that has gained considerable attention is the use of high-quality slow-release organic fertilizers. These fertilizers offer a gradual nutrient release, which can significantly enhance soil health, improve crop yields, and reduce the environmental impact of farming.


Understanding Slow-Release Organic Fertilizers


Slow-release fertilizers are designed to release nutrients over an extended period, as opposed to conventional fertilizers that provide an immediate surge of nutrients. This slow-release mechanism helps to ensure that plants receive a steady supply of essential nutrients throughout their growth cycle, which is particularly important during critical growth phases. Organic options, made from natural materials, not only nourish plants but also enhance the biological activity within the soil.


High-quality slow-release organic fertilizers are often derived from compost, manure, or natural minerals. They are rich in essential macro and micronutrients, such as nitrogen (N), phosphorus (P), and potassium (K), as well as beneficial microorganisms that contribute to soil health. Unlike synthetic fertilizers, which can lead to nutrient leaching and soil degradation, organic fertilizers improve soil structure, increase water retention, and promote beneficial microbial populations.


Benefits of Slow-Release Organic Fertilizers


1. Reduced Nutrient Leaching One of the significant advantages of slow-release organic fertilizers is their ability to minimize nutrient leaching. Because the nutrients are released gradually, they are less likely to wash away during rainfall or irrigation, thus preserving them within the soil and making them available for plant uptake when needed.

2. Improved Soil Health High-quality organic fertilizers enhance soil health by increasing organic matter and promoting microbial growth. Healthy soil is crucial for sustainable crop production as it enhances nutrient availability, improves soil structure, and boosts water retention. This contributes to healthier plants that are more resilient to pests and diseases.


3. Sustained Plant Growth The slow nutrient release promotes sustained plant growth by providing a consistent supply of nutrients over time. This leads to improved crop quality and yield, as plants can continue to draw upon available nutrients throughout their development.


4. Environmental Benefits The use of organic fertilizers reduces the reliance on chemical pesticides and fertilizers, which can negatively impact water quality and biodiversity. By adopting slow-release organic options, farmers can practice more environmentally friendly agricultural methods that protect natural ecosystems.


5. Cost-Effectiveness Although the initial price of high-quality slow-release organic fertilizers may be higher than synthetic alternatives, their long-term benefits often outweigh the costs. Greater nutrient efficiency results in lower application rates, less frequent applications, and ultimately, reduced fertilizer costs for farmers.
